Maintaining a healthy blood sugar range is essential for overall well-being. The American Diabetes Association recommends that adults have their blood glucose levels checked regularly, especially if they're at risk of developing diabetes or have been diagnosed with the condition. Knowing what constitutes a normal blood sugar range can help you take proactive steps towards maintaining your health.
For most adults, a normal fasting blood sugar level is between 70 and 99 mg/dL (milligrams per deciliter). After eating, blood glucose levels typically peak around 1-2 hours later and should return to the normal range within 2-3 hours. However, this can vary depending on factors such as age, physical activity level, and medication use.
The Importance of Tracking Your Blood Sugar Range
Regular monitoring is crucial in understanding your body's response to diet, exercise, and other lifestyle factors. There are several ways to track blood sugar levels at home using glucometers or continuous glucose monitors (CGM). These devices provide accurate readings that can help you identify patterns and make informed decisions about managing your blood sugar range.
When tracking your blood sugar, it's essential to follow a consistent testing schedule. Typically, this involves checking fasting levels in the morning before eating and postprandial levels 1-2 hours after meals. However, some people may need to check their levels more frequently depending on their individual needs.
Why Fluctuations Matter: Understanding Blood Sugar Spikes and Drops
Blood sugar fluctuations can be a concern for anyone with diabetes or those who are trying to manage their blood glucose levels. While minor spikes in blood sugar might not cause significant issues, frequent or severe episodes of high blood sugar (hyperglycemia) can lead to complications such as nerve damage, kidney disease, and vision problems.
Conversely, low blood sugar (hypoglycemia) is a critical condition that requires immediate attention. Severe hypoglycemic episodes can cause confusion, loss of consciousness, and even death if left untreated. Maintaining stable blood glucose levels through diet, exercise, and medication adherence helps mitigate these risks.
How Diet Impacts Your Blood Sugar Range
The foods we eat have a significant impact on our blood sugar ranges. Foods with high glycemic index (GI) values are rapidly digested and absorbed by the body, causing a quick spike in blood glucose levels. On the other hand, whole, unprocessed foods tend to be lower on the GI scale and promote stable energy production.
Including fiber-rich foods such as fruits, vegetables, and legumes can help slow down carbohydrate digestion and absorption, thus preventing rapid spikes in blood sugar. Similarly, healthy fats from sources like nuts, seeds, avocados, and olive oil support sustained glucose release into the bloodstream.
The Role of Exercise in Maintaining a Healthy Blood Sugar Range
Regular physical activity is essential for maintaining insulin sensitivity and keeping blood sugar levels within target ranges. Even moderate-intensity exercise can improve muscle uptake of glucose from the bloodstream, reducing postprandial spikes in blood sugar.
Aerobic exercises such as brisk walking, cycling, or swimming are excellent options for managing blood glucose levels. Additionally, strength training activities like weightlifting help build muscle mass that increases insulin sensitivity and supports optimal energy utilization by the body's cells.
Managing Stress to Maintain a Healthy Blood Sugar Range
Stress is a natural response to perceived threats but can have significant effects on our bodies when experienced chronically or excessively. High levels of cortisol, often referred to as the "stress hormone," disrupt normal physiological processes including glucose metabolism and insulin sensitivity.
Maintaining healthy stress management techniques such as meditation, yoga, deep breathing exercises, and spending time in nature helps mitigate the negative impact of chronic stress on blood sugar ranges. By adopting these strategies into your daily routine, you can help promote balance between body and mind while reducing risk factors for various diseases including diabetes.
What Can You Do If Your Blood Sugar Range Is Too High?
If your fasting or postprandial glucose levels consistently exceed 126 mg/dL or more than two readings are higher than the upper limit of the normal range, it may indicate that you need to take corrective action. The first step involves reviewing and adjusting diet choices as previously discussed.
Increasing physical activity through regular exercise sessions can also improve insulin sensitivity and reduce blood sugar ranges over time. For those taking medication for diabetes or prediabetes management, consulting with your healthcare provider is essential to ensure safe adjustment of treatment plans in conjunction with these lifestyle changes.
